Next up: the Amazing Thailand app (iPhone version, iPad ‘HD’ version, both free) – produced by the Tourism Authority of Thailand, it aims squarely at the rich tourists interested in shopping and living it up. The app is fairly straightforward, featuring information on destinations, events, promotions, and so on. A few of the sections are a bit slow to load, as though there was very little data built into the app. A nice section on food unfortunately gets hidden under a ‘More’ section, and there’s a lot of data to peruse here.
The text, however, could use some work. Without needing to peruse more than a handful of pages you’ll find more than a few oddball English errors – not exactly a vote of confidence. A neat augmented reality feature screams ‘golly gee whiz’, but in reality is far from helpful, especially in a central urban area.
There’s a lot going on here, and it really would help to have a bit more organization here. It’s free, however, and gives tourists a decent starting place. I wouldn’t use it for any serious traveling, and it’s less helpful than it looks.
